This is a modded save with Py and some QoL mods. There is a consistent and reproduceable crash when taking iron ore out of a furnace.
To reproduce:
- Load save
- Open furnace next to player (should have 50 iron ore in it)
- Shift-click to remove ore from furnace
- Game crashes
Removing the ash first will allow you to remove the iron ore without crashing the game.
[1.1.72] Crash when taking iron ore out of a furnace
[1.1.72] Crash when taking iron ore out of a furnace
- Attachments
-
- factorio crash.png (2.24 MiB) Viewed 3095 times
-
- factorio-current.log
- (85.86 KiB) Downloaded 100 times
-
- factorio-dump-current.dmp
- (1.09 MiB) Downloaded 79 times
-
- Py Energy 3 - 05 Crashy Iron.zip
- (10.08 MiB) Downloaded 94 times
Re: [1.1.72] Crash when taking iron ore out of a furnace
Quick update:
I've confirmed this is reproducible on multiple saves and different machines. It only happens when the following conditions are met:
- The furnace is completely full of ash (1k ash) and paused due to this condition
- There is fuel and enough ore in the furnace to begin a new production cycle
- The current production progress is 0%
- Enough ore is removed to prevent the furnace from being able to begin the next production cycle (in the iron ore example, bringing the ore count under 10)
Removing ash or fuel to leave this state first allows you to remove the ore without crashing.
I've confirmed this is reproducible on multiple saves and different machines. It only happens when the following conditions are met:
- The furnace is completely full of ash (1k ash) and paused due to this condition
- There is fuel and enough ore in the furnace to begin a new production cycle
- The current production progress is 0%
- Enough ore is removed to prevent the furnace from being able to begin the next production cycle (in the iron ore example, bringing the ore count under 10)
Removing ash or fuel to leave this state first allows you to remove the ore without crashing.
Re: [1.1.72] Crash when taking iron ore out of a furnace
Thanks for the report. It's now fixed for the next release.
If you want to get ahold of me I'm almost always on Discord.